如何在 Debian Bullseye 上安装“libspotify12”?

如何在 Debian Bullseye 上安装“libspotify12”?

我正在运行 Debian GNU/Linux 11(bullseye)。

我正在尝试为终端安装 Tizonia 云音乐播放器。我运行了以下命令:

curl -kL https://github.com/tizonia/tizonia-openmax-il/raw/master/tools/install.sh | bash

但我最终收到以下错误:

E: Unable to locate package libspotify12

这会停止安装,并且也使得我无法使用此命令清理混乱的情况:

sudo apt-get -y remove --purge tizonia-all && sudo apt-get -y autoremove

因为 Tizonia 从来没有被安装过:

E: Unable to locate package tizonia-all

libspotify12为了让安装正常进行,我应该将哪个源添加到我的 Debian APT 源列表中以获取访问权限?

答案1

libspotify是专有代码,因此不能托管在 Debian 的存储库中。它位于开发者 Mopidy 自己的 APT 存储库

自述文件是这样说的:

从 APT 档案安装

如果你想安装该软件包,可以从 Mopidy APT 存档中安装:https://apt.mopidy.com/

  1. 添加档案的 GPG 密钥:

    wget -q -O - https://apt.mopidy.com/mopidy.gpg | sudo apt-key add -
    
  2. 将以下内容添加到/etc/apt/sources.list,或者如果您有目录,则将其添加到该目录中/etc/apt/sources.list.d/名为的文件中 :mopidy.list

    sudo wget -q -O /etc/apt/sources.list.d/mopidy.list https://apt.mopidy.com/stretch.list
    
  3. 安装软件包:

    sudo apt-get update
    sudo apt-get install libspotify12 libspotify-dev
    

答案2

我自己还没有尝试过,但是可以尝试一下 -

https://github.com/mopidy/libspotify-deb

相关内容